Google is making AI in Gmail and Docs free - but raising the price of Workspace
Briefly

Jerry Dischler, Google's president of cloud applications, emphasizes that the new pricing allows widespread access to AI features, alleviating cost concerns for companies, which were often hesitant to adopt due to expenses. By integrating AI seamlessly into the Workspace, Google aims to enhance user engagement and provide tangible value. The pricing shift reflects recognition of the needs of businesses looking to leverage AI without staggering costs, fostering broader adoption.
With the inclusion of AI features like email summaries in Gmail and generated designs for spreadsheets, Google Workspace is becoming a more robust tool, aiming at making daily tasks more efficient for users. The powerful NotebookLM research assistant and the Gemini bot could significantly transform productivity by automating tedious tasks and aiding in searching for information. This enhancement proves that Google's focus is not just on features but also on enhancing overall user experience.
